WebMedicare includes hospital insurance (Part A), medical insurance (Part B) and prescription drug coverage (Part D). Medicaid is a state-administered health insurance program available to certain low-income individuals and families who fit into a recognized eligibility group. WebPart A covers inpatient hospital stays, care in a skilled nursing facility, hospice care, and some home health care. Medicare Part B (Medical Insurance) Part B covers certain doctors' services, outpatient care, medical supplies, and preventive services.
